Building on the strength of the university’s leadership team, Huron President Dr. Barry Craig welcomes the arrival of Huron’s first ever Chief Financial Officer (CFO), Erica Willick CPA, CA.
“As our new CFO, Erica will be instrumental in shaping and executing the financial strategy and contributing to the overall success of Huron’s unique mission in the market,” said Dr. Craig. “She has a proven track record as a strategic financial leader with over 20 years’ experience in helping mission-driven organizations meet the complex needs of their stakeholders and compete in a variety of sectors.”
Erica is a Chartered Professional Accountant, with an HBA from Ivey Business School and holds a certificate in CFO Leadership from the Rotman School of Management. She has also taught fourth year courses at the Ivey Business School.
Prior to arriving at Huron, Erica spent several years as the Chief Operating Officer at Callon Dietz Inc. engineering firm and earlier as Director of Finance at Dillon Consulting. She has most recently helped lead an ambitious $20M fundraising and capital project to build the new Humane Society facility in London as the Director of Finance and Capital Project Manager at the Humane Society, London & Middlesex.
As someone with a passion for collaboration and community development, Erica feels her personal interests are well aligned with the university’s vision. “I am most excited about supporting Huron’s mission that nurtures current and future leaders who will make a positive difference in the world. Like anything, it takes a community of dedicated people working together to create a truly sustainable future,” she says.
Erica’s experience and acumen will help build upon Huron’s recent growth and support the Huron community in meeting its goals as outlined within its new strategic plan.
